My husband and I are retired school teachers and usually plan our own trips, however because Romania is brand new to us, I checked online. When I read reviews of Raluca I was convinced to give it a try. I was not the easiest client, because first I said we like to hike. When Raluca offered us a complete hiking vacation, I saw that would be too much. So she changed our itinerary to include one all day hike in Craiului National Park and the rest exploring old Saxon villages, going in a rental car. Our nine day road trip included quaint hotels and guest houses in the old town section of each village. If you want first class lodging, I suggest booking it yourself and keep to the big city hotels. But if you really want an authentic experience where you meet real people, go with Raluca. A couple of times we felt stuck and had questions. Both times Raluca answered our call right away and got us answers.

Our most memorable night was our “night in a museum” where our guest house was a farm house in the small village of Viscri, a UNESCO World Cultural Heritage Site. We have visited a couple of museum villages in Europe where they have houses set up to show how people lived 100 to 300 years ago. The beds were fine and the food very good, down home cooking, the sense of community among the other boarders was very welcoming.

I cannot do this review without mentioning a place we were fortunate to stay two nights; that was at Casa Dobre, in the village of Madura, in the Carpathian Alps. This couple were so nice, they made our stay outstanding. Most places serve you breakfast. They served dinner as well, with home made plum schnapps on the side, plus whatever beverage you wanted, including beer or wine. And both mornings they sent us off with a sack lunch, because they wouldn’t want us to starve! And the views all around them were Sound-of-Music BEAUTIFUL!

Every time we thought we might have a problem, such as with parking in the pedestrian zone of little old downtowns, where we were always booked, things were fine when we got there. We have no regrets at booking with Kimkim and Raluca at Romania Active.

We are very disappointed with our experience with KimKim on what should have been a great trip. Randall was helpful in laying out an itinerary that suited our needs. The quoted price seem quite a bit higher relative to the experience of friends and family who have been to Costa Rica, which prompted us to ask about any included fees. Randall said that all contracts with tour operators were "confidential" and that "all benefits are passed along to you." He insisted that there were no added fees beyond what was shown at the end.

The tours and experiences that Randall had booked for us were actually prominently advertised with their prices in every hotel we visited. All the hotels themselves also had their rates prominently displayed. Once we added it all up, we realized that KimKim had charged us more than a 30% premium on every activity and hotel as well as added on the fee at the end. Given the price, the lack of unique experiences that we all readily bookable everywhere, we would never use this service again. If you like the convenience and are willing to pay the huge premium, this is a great service. However, be aware that there is no transparency with regards to this premium and you can probably do just as well booking with your local reputable hotel from one of the major sites.
